Output e7bc3f39f3891e69e60101c6f73f4c8fc4b322c325d51e74d9eb8eecc843765e:5

value
1519700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c005362666c12ba4b697248beca65e2a58a4af3b OP_EQUAL
address
3KCKuUgtjDfXqrCwsojyvJ7aQoPctwUyt7
transaction
e7bc3f39f3891e69e60101c6f73f4c8fc4b322c325d51e74d9eb8eecc843765e
spent
true